This book is a comic strip collection, featuring reprinted comics from the Sunday paper during the 1960s! It is full of our favorite characters, including Charlie Brown. I like this book because it is funny and entertaining. There is always someone getting into mischief. Charlie Brown is gullible and sweet, and he is constantly getting tricked by Lucy with the football!

One of my favorite panels is when Snoopy is too cold outside, so he knocks to come in. After Charlie Brown lets him in, Snoopy feels stuffy, so he knocks to go back out. Then it rains, and he knocks to come back in, much to Charlie Brown’s frustration! It’s so funny, because my dog does the same thing! Another panel that was especially funny to me was when Lucy takes Linus’s blanket to wash it and he freaks out until she returns it. He can’t be without his lovie!

All lovers of the Peanuts gang will enjoy this book, so I recommend it to anyone who would like a good laugh. If you’re feeling grumpy, this is the perfect book to pick up to change sad feelings into happy ones.
